Tekijä: | Premeaux, S.R. |
Otsikko: | Undergraduate student perceptions regarding cheating: Tier 1 versus tier 2 AACSB accredited business schools |
Lehti: | Journal of Business Ethics
2006 : JAN II, VOL. 63:2, p. 407-418 |
Asiasana: | business schools ethics students |
Kieli: | eng |
Tiivistelmä: | This paper discusses cheating at Tiers 1 and 2 AACSB accredited business schools. Distinct differences exist; Tier 1 students are more likely to cheat on written assignments, they believe sanctions impact cheating, and that a stigma is attached to cheating. Tier 2 students are more likely to cheat on exams, and nearly as likely to cheat on written assignment. Tier 2 students accept the notion that moral and ethical people cheat. |
